首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

开源分布式数据库

是一种使用开源软件进行数据存储和管理的分布式系统。它将数据分散存储在多个节点上,通过并行处理和复制机制来提高系统的性能和可靠性。以下是对开源分布式数据库的完善且全面的答案:

概念: 开源分布式数据库是指开源社区或组织提供的、支持分布式数据存储和管理的数据库系统。它采用分布式架构,将数据存储在多个节点上,并通过分片、复制和数据分发等技术来提高性能和可靠性。

分类: 开源分布式数据库可以分为多种类型,包括关系型分布式数据库、键值型分布式数据库、文档型分布式数据库、列式分布式数据库等。不同类型的数据库适用于不同的数据存储和查询需求。

优势:

  1. 高可靠性:由于数据被复制到多个节点上,即使某个节点发生故障,系统仍然可以继续工作,不会导致数据丢失。
  2. 高性能:通过数据分片和并行处理,分布式数据库可以提供更高的吞吐量和更低的延迟,满足大规模数据处理和高并发访问的需求。
  3. 扩展性:分布式数据库可以根据数据量的增长进行水平扩展,通过添加更多的节点来提高系统的容量和吞吐量。
  4. 灵活性:分布式数据库支持数据模型的多样性,可以存储结构化数据、半结构化数据和非结构化数据,满足不同应用场景的需求。

应用场景: 开源分布式数据库广泛应用于互联网、电子商务、物联网、大数据分析等领域,包括用户数据存储、实时分析、日志处理、推荐系统、广告投放等应用场景。

推荐的腾讯云相关产品: 腾讯云提供了一系列开源分布式数据库相关产品,包括TDSQL、TBase、DCDB等。这些产品具有高可用性、高性能和可扩展性,并提供了丰富的功能和工具,帮助用户轻松构建和管理分布式数据库。

  • TDSQL:TDSQL是腾讯云提供的一种高度可扩展的关系型分布式数据库服务,支持MySQL和PostgreSQL两种引擎,适用于大规模数据存储和高并发访问的场景。了解更多:TDSQL产品介绍
  • TBase:TBase是腾讯云提供的一种新一代分布式关系型数据库,支持分布式事务、多维查询等高级功能,适用于复杂的事务处理和分析型应用。了解更多:TBase产品介绍
  • DCDB:DCDB是腾讯云提供的一种分布式关系型数据库服务,支持高可用性和自动扩缩容,适用于在线事务处理和大规模数据存储的场景。了解更多:DCDB产品介绍

以上是对开源分布式数据库的完善且全面的答案,希望能够满足您的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券